Is this trip right for you?
verified
The Ocean Albatros is an ice-strengthened ship – large, sturdy and suited to the unpredictable Antarctic waters. Some people may experience seasickness in occasional rough seas. We have a doctor on board should you need assistance. Over-the-counter seasickness medication is usually an easy fix.
verified
Temperatures in the Antarctic can get very cold, but it can also get surprisingly warm when the sun comes out. We recommend dressing in layers when you journey outside. We’ll loan you a waterproof jacket and waterproof boots that are sturdy and warm. Please see the Essential Trip Information for a packing list.
verified
Depending on the weather, you’ll be travelling in a Zodiac boat quite regularly to explore the areas and search for wildlife. It can get cold and wet on the Zodiac, so make sure you dress appropriately and keep your camera safe and dry. A fair level of mobility is needed for wet and dry landings from the boat, as well as on steep terrain, snow and other uneven surfaces. Elevators may be closed in rough seas, requiring the use of stairs for meals, presentations and activities.
verified
The weather plays a pivotal part in this adventure and, although there’s an itinerary in place, there are no guarantees that you’ll be able to do everything that is planned. A level of flexibility and openness to embracing the unexpected are important in expedition travel, especially in an area as remote as the Antarctic. There are nearly 200 recognised sites in the Antarctic Peninsula and South Shetlands – the places mentioned in the itinerary may need to be changed to other locations, which are just as interesting and beautiful!
verified
We may be confined to the ship during rough weather, but there are plenty of onboard resources and activities. The ship’s library and educational lectures are ideal ways to stay entertained, while the gym will keep you fresh for when the weather clears.
